Hard or easy?

When visiting on different church on Sunday there was something I heard that struck me, something i have heard in different contexts before and wonder what impact it should have on the way we approach life and ministry. To paraphrase:

When we present the gospel as something that is going to be hard, sacrificial etc people are drawn to it. When we say Jesus loves you, He wants to bless you, people say, “no thanks”.

I wonder of this is because within ourselves we long for something more than ourselves. Scripture says eternity is written on our hearts, and I feel when we are presented with the call of God and who He is there is a natural reaction (pull to or strong resistence). When we are presented with a God who just wants to make our lives better then we aren’t interested because we have other things that make our life good. We need to stop making the blessings of God a selling point for salvation. we need to surrender to God because He is God and with out Him we are in big trouble.
